At present, Emperor Huizong of the Song Dynasty has just ascended the throne, and Taiwei is still one of the three official positions, which will be officially disbanded in a few years.

Therefore, Xu Yun directly gave up the idea of ​​asking Lao Su for his list - in normal history, when Lao Su died, the Taiwei was still the Third Duke.

According to subsequent developments, Song Huizong would divide the Taiwei into nine positions in a few years.

They are the commander of the capital in front of the palace, the deputy commander of the capital, and the marquis of Du Yu; the commander of the horse army of the bodyguard, the deputy commander of the capital, and the marquis of Du Yu; the commander of the infantry of the bodyguard, the deputy commander, and the marquis of Du Yu. .

They are also known as the three commanders of the palace, the three commanders of the horse army, and the three commanders of the infantry respectively, and collectively they are called the nine commanders in front of the palace.

Among them, Gao Qiu's real position in "Water Margin" was one of the three commanders of the palace.

That's why he was called the Palace Commander and the Taiwei.

It even develops according to the plot in "Water Margin".

Song Jiang was later granted the title of Chuzhou's pacification envoy, and Wu Yong was granted the title of Wu Shengjun's propaganda envoy. They were also qualified to be called "Song Taiwei" and "Wu Taiwei".
